X-ray photograph of the hand of Arthur James Balfour Gliddon and St Paul's CathedralX ray image of Lord Balfour's left hand showing its bones and a faint outline of the soft tissue of his fingers, darkening towards his hand and wrist. Signed and dated on the print, below the thumb: 'Arthur James Balfour May 6th 1896'. Inscribed in pencil verso: 'Taken by A. A. Campbell Swinton at the Royal Society's Soiree held on 6 May 1896.' With a paper label verso, stamped: 'FROM MR. SWINTONS PHOTOGRAPHIC LABORATORY, 66, VICTORIA STREET, S. W.'.
